Transaction 12c60f9474b8cc83dcb6014dc700fb7eaa8afa32d41383aee8044f8b78499699

block
86d27c2394fabfaee8a12a0c27835cd7db41cf05ea9c16bdbcece17d6f5cb2f7

1 Input

23 Outputs